I listed two of my recent customs on ebay. I was happy to have them snagged at a BIN, and send a combined shipping invoice. I then got this reply in my messages. After talking to some pony friends the general thought it it is just buyer's remorse.
Her ID is plushies2011
hello i would like to cancel these as my little 8 year old sister sophie was trying to save the picture for later and though that this was my photobucket account she loves mlp and thought they where so pretty and clicked buy instead of watchlist i am so sorry about this i really am i told her if she finds any pictures she likes ill have them printed out onto a tshirt for her but sadly sophie didnt realize that i had my ebay page up i am sorry for any incopnvience we have caused you, sophie has leukmia and is often on the computert asd she is too sick to go outside most of the time, she thought your ponies where so pretty ...beside i wont be able to pay till 25th as im away till then so sorry about this terrible mixup so can you please cancel both ponies please and thank youmany thanks

If her little sister is on the computer that much then she definitely knew what she was doing. If you are away then why is your eBay account logged on in the first place?

Get your fees back by at least doing a mutual cancellation or else open an unpaid bidder dispute so that the strikes show on their account.
